Online Buyers Benefit from New AuctionSHARK Upgrades
Shopping comparison site AuctionSHARK now allows users to
Find, Compare & Buy from more than 100 million listings on top online auctions
and thousands of online stores.
CASTLE ROCK, CO - September 7, 2006 - The Auction
Shark, LLC (AuctionSHARK) recently made significant upgrades to its shopping comparison
website at www.auctionshark.com. AuctionSHARK
is now searching over 100 million item listings from top online auction sites like
eBay and Overstock Auctions, as well as more than 5,000 online stores.
In addition to the considerable increase in searchable listings, AuctionSHARK redesigned
the look and feel of its home page and search results. "This new design is simpler
and makes the user experience much better," said Brian Kitt, Senior Developer with
AuctionSHARK. "The user pages will be undergoing a similar facelift and improvement,
but we wanted to bring these changes to market as quickly as possible."
The search process has also been upgraded so that users now have the ability to
refine their search along the way by adding criteria such as Brand, Color or Style
to a given search. "This latest upgrade gives user more control and simplifies the
search process," said Michael Zak, founder and principal at AuctionSHARK. "Whether
a user is looking for something in-season or out of season - commodity or collectible,
by searching both online auctions and stores, users have the best opportunity to
save money and find what they are looking for, all on one site."
AuctionSHARK is currently developing additional tools to further empower online
buyers, and further expand its auction and store search results.
